If you take a Ghana gap year you’ll be visiting a country which enjoys a reputation as being one of the friendliest and safest destinations in Africa. The main reasons why Ghana travel is so popular is it's incredible array of wildlife. On a gap year in Ghana it’s possible to see a wide range of wildlife, from forest elephants to colobus monkeys. Africa conservation is a great option for your Ghana gap year. A great way to relax and unwind on a gap year in Ghana is by spending time on some of its superb beaches, many of which also have a thriving surf scene.

One of the rewarding Ghana gap year options is to do some Ghana volunteer work whilst you’re out there. Real Gap provides a wide range of worthwhile volunteer projects on your gap year in Ghana – from working in healthcare to helping out an orphanage. See below for our Ghana gap year options.
